2773 - Choronayim

Strong's Concordance

Original word: חֹרוֹנָ֫יִם
Transliteration: Choronayim
Definition (short): Horonaim
Definition (full): Horonaim -- |two hollows|, a place in Moab

NAS Exhaustive Concordance

Word Origin: from the same as Beth (in part)
Definition: |two hollows,| a place in Moab
NASB Translation: Horonaim (4).

Strong's Exhaustive Concordance

Dual of a derivative from chowr; double cave-town; Choronajim, a place in Moab -- Horonaim.
